Solstice::Session - Manage a Solstice Tools session.
use CGI;
use Solstice::Session;
my $session = Solstice::Session->new;
#or, if you'd like to use a custom session name for the cookie
my $session = Solstice::Session->new('custom_name');
my $cookie = $session->cookie();
print CGI->header(-cookie => $cookie);
## To retrieve the session information
my $session = Solstice::Session->new;
$session->set('mydata', $mydata);
$session->get('mydata');
